Hmmm...I truly hope the setlist is a touch different than it was last night in Vancouver. As posted, it was:

Stinkfist
The Pot
Forty Six & 2
Jambi
Schism
Rosetta Stoned
Sober
Right In Two
Lateralus
Vicarious
Ćnema

I would like to see Schism replaced with Eulogy, and Pushit added after Right in Two.

Also...I heard so many rumblings of Tool using Wings or 10 000 Days as a sound check song, but they've yet to perform it live. Here's hoping by the time our show rolls around that they've decided to include them.
